Rice Cooker Cupcakes

Servings
2
Prep Time
5 minutes
Cook Time
15 minutes
maple_steamed_cupcake1_instagram-jpg

Ingredients

  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tbsp vegetable oil
  • 1 tbsp maple syrup
  • 3 tbsp plain yogurt
  • 1½ tbsp sugar
  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p milk powder
  • Whipped cream or frosting, for topping

Directions

  1. In a medium-sized bowl, whisk together the egg, vegetable oil, maple syrup, and yogurt until well incorporated.
  2. Add the sugar to the mixture and mix thoroughly.
  3. Sift the flour, milk powder, and baking powder together to remove any clumps. Add this dry mixture into the egg mixture and fold until you have a thick batter consistency.
  4. Divide the batter evenly into four cupcake liners.
  5. Place each cupcake liner in the steam tray of your rice cooker.
  6. Select the Steam function on your rice cooker and let the cupcakes bake for about 15 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  7. Once the cupcakes are done, carefully remove them from the steam tray and allow them to cool completely before frosting.
  8. Once cooled, top the cupcakes with whipped cream or your choice of frosting.
